Summary

Summary

A guide to CAM technology which provides coverage of cams in industrial machinery, automotive optimization, and gadgets and inventions. It provides information on: the advantages of cams compared to other motion devices; computer-aided design and manufacturing techniques; numerical controls for manufacturing; and, dynamics of high-speed systems.
